Are Phone Photos Good Enough to Print?

Yes — modern smartphones are more powerful than ever.

Most newer phones:

  • Shoot 12MP or higher

  • Capture sharp detail

  • Handle low light better than older cameras

  • Produce files large enough for standard print sizes

For everyday prints like 4×6, 5×7, and 8×10, phone photos usually look fantastic.

Even larger prints like 16×20 can look great if the photo is sharp and properly exposed.


What Size Can I Print From My Phone?

It depends on the quality of the image, but here’s a general guide:

  • 4×6 → Almost always safe

  • 5×7 → Very safe

  • 8×10 → Usually safe

  • 11×14 → Depends on cropping

  • 16×20 and larger → Best with minimal cropping

If you zoomed in heavily or cropped a lot, that reduces quality for large prints.


What Affects Print Quality From a Phone?

Even though phones are powerful, a few things can lower print quality:

  • Screenshots instead of original photos

  • Images downloaded from social media

  • Heavy cropping

  • Low lighting or motion blur

  • Using digital zoom instead of moving closer

For best results:

  • Upload the original photo file

  • Avoid sending compressed versions

  • Don’t take a screenshot of your photo


Do Phone Photos Get Cropped When Printed?

Yes — sometimes.

Most phones shoot in a 4:3 ratio.
Some print sizes (like 8×10) use a 4:5 ratio.

That means part of the top or bottom may be trimmed slightly.

To avoid surprises:

  • Preview your crop before ordering

  • Leave space around important subjects

  • Choose a size that matches your photo’s shape

Quick Tips Before Printing From Your Phone

  • Turn off filters before printing

  • Check that faces are in focus

  • Don’t over-edit brightness or contrast

  • Use WiFi or AirDrop to transfer full-resolution files

  • Ask if you’re unsure about sizing
